Doppler Ultrasound: Color Flow Mapping & Aliasing

A real-time 3D model of pulsed-wave color Doppler ultrasound: a transducer insonates pulsatile blood flow through a vessel, and every simulated red blood cell is colored live by its true Doppler shift, exactly the way a clinical color-flow map works. Push the peak velocity or lower the pulse repetition frequency far enough and the unambiguous Nyquist limit is exceeded — the color map wraps and flips from red to blue in the middle of the jet, reproducing the aliasing artifact sonographers see and correct for every day at the bedside.
